Bank of America, founded in 1904 as the Bank of Italy by Amadeo Giannini to serve immigrants in San Francisco, is now one of the largest financial institutions in the world, headquartered in Charlotte, North Carolina, following its 1998 merger with NationsBank. It provides a broad spectrum of services, including consumer banking, wealth management (through its Merrill division), commercial banking, and investment banking, managing trillions in assets and serving millions of customers globally.

Bank of America's Q4 2023 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2023, Bank of America held 8,460 positions worth $993B, up 9.3% from $908B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 16% of the portfolio.

Bank of America's Q4 2023 filing shows 676 new, 3,580 increased, 2,939 reduced and 477 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Veralto: 2,923,943 shares worth $241M. The largest sale was Invesco QQQ Trust, an estimated $2.41B.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 13% of assets, up from 12%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Healthcare.
